Why hire a coach in Rome?

Rome draws millions of visitors annually. Tourism groups, Vatican delegations and conference attendees rely on coach hire for reliable transfers, guided tours and multi-day Italian itineraries.

With two airports — Fiumicino (FCO) 32 km from the centre and Ciampino (CIA) 15 km away — Rome is a major gateway for group travel. Transferring 20 or more people from Fiumicino to a hotel near the Spanish Steps is far more efficient by coach than by taxi or train, especially with luggage.

Rome is also a key stop on multi-city Italian tours. Groups regularly travel by coach from Rome to Florence, Naples, Pompeii and the Amalfi Coast. Having a dedicated vehicle and driver for the entire itinerary eliminates the hassle of multiple bookings and connections.

Airport transfers

Fiumicino (FCO) & Ciampino (CIA)

Fiumicino is 32 km from the city centre with 4 terminals — Terminal 1 and Terminal 3 handle most international traffic. Ciampino is 15 km from the centre and serves low-cost carriers like Ryanair and Wizz Air. Both airports have designated coach pickup areas.

Good to know

Local tips for Rome

Rome's ZTL (Zona a Traffico Limitato) is strictly enforced in the historic centre — cameras capture every entry. Our drivers have all required permits and know the ZTL boundaries, active hours and exemption routes inside out.

Coach parking near the Vatican and Colosseum is limited and regulated. We coordinate drop-off and pickup at designated spots such as Via Crescenzio for the Vatican and Via dei Fori Imperiali for the Colosseum, so your group spends time sightseeing, not searching for parking.

Summer temperatures in Rome often exceed 35 degrees Celsius — air-conditioned coaches are essential from June through September. The city is also busiest with tourists during Easter week and the summer months, so early booking is strongly recommended for these periods.
